WORK AREA PRECAUTIONS
See Figure 14.
 Cut only wood or materials made from wood, no
sheet metal, no plastics, no masonry, no non-
wood building materials.
 Never allow children to operate the saw. Allow no
person to use this chain saw who has not read this
Operator's Manual or received adequate instruc-
tions for the safe and proper use of this chain saw.
 When felling a tree, keep everyone - helpers,
bystanders, children, and animals - a safe distance
from the cutting area. During felling operations, the
safe distance should be a least twice the height of
the largest trees in the felling area. During bucking
operations, keep a minimum distance of 15 feet
between workers.Trees should not be felled in a
manner that would endanger any person, strike
any utility line or cause any property damage. If
the tree does make contact with any utility line, the
utility company should be notified immediately.
 Always cut with both feet on solid ground to pre-
vent being pulled off balance.
 Do not cut above chest height, as a saw held high-
er is difficult to control against kickback forces.
 Do not fell trees near electrical wires or buildings.
Leave this operation for professionals.
 Cut only when visibility and light are adequate for
you to see clearly.
FELLING TREES
See Figures 14 - 17.
HAZARDOUS CONDITIONS
WARNING:
Do not fell trees during periods of high wind or
heavy precipitation. Wait until the hazardous
weather has ended.
